New York State Attorney General filed a lawsuit seeking to recover 2.2 million US dollars Cryptocurrency suspected of work fraud

New York Attorney General Letitia James has taken legal action to recover more than $2 million in Cryptocurrency that was scammed. The scammers promised remote job opportunities to lure these victims into purchasing Cryptocurrency. James stated in a recent statement: “Scammers are sending text messages to New York residents, promising them high-paying, flexible jobs, only to lure them into buying cryptocurrency and then stealing cryptocurrency from them.” With the assistance of the U.S. Secret Service, James stated that the stolen cryptocurrency has been frozen, and urged people to be wary of suspicious text messages from unknown senders, especially those claiming to offer job or other opportunities.
